Intervention / Comparator Agent
|
| Type |
Name |
Details |
| Intervention |
Propofol TIVA |
Maintenance of anaesthesia will be done using target controlled infusion of propofol, using Schnieder model for effect site concentration, along with endotracheal intubation and controlled ventilation. |
| Comparator Agent |
Volatile Anaesthetic. |
Maintenance of anaesthesia will be done using volatile inhaled anaesthetics namely isoflurane, nitrous oxide (1-1.3 MAC) along with endotracheal intubation and controlled ventilation. |

Brief Summary
|
Background In India, breast cancer is the most prevalent cancer form among women which accounted for 1,62,468 new incidences and 87,090 deaths in 2018 (“Breast Cancer - India Against Cancerâ€). At our hospital, we have done total of 1270 cases of mastectomy in last five years, left behind number of inoperable cases. More than 90 % of the women diagnosed with breast cancer (Stage I, II and III) undergo surgery and it is important to decipher how the peri-operative management may affect the outcome. During the peri-operative period, surgery induced stress responses and anaesthetic-induced immune suppression may play a critical role in establishment and growth of metastatic lesions. A lot of literature reviews support this claim of role of anaesthetic technique on balance between pro-tumour and tumour-resisting factors and thus facilitation breast cancer recurrence or metastasis. Maximum studies reported till date are retrospective study and none in Indian scenario. This is an investigator initiated, prospective and comparative study proposal form the Department of Anesthesiology ,where a pilot project on the subject stated above with assistance of research wing of the Institute is proposed, the result of which may indicate a change in mode of anesthesia in case of cancer surgery in future. Scope of Work There are no human studies on the isolated effect of volatile anaesthetics on tumour metastasis. Since inhaled anaesthetics have direct and indirect effects on different aspects of the immune response, it is reasonable to assert that they are important factors for postoperative immune suppression and residual malignant cell migration and invasion (Laudanski et al. 2016).Although no optimal anaesthetic combination has been identified for patients undergoing breast cancer resection, Eden et al. in 2018 proposed that an ideal anaesthetic in the breast cancer patient population would involve a combination of total intravenous anaesthesia (TIVA) (propofol), regional anaesthesia (para-vertebral block), non-opioid sedatives (clonidine or dexmedetomidine), and COX-2 inhibition (ketorolac) (Eden et al. 2018). At present in India there are no prospective studies on comparative analysis of isoflurane and propofol with reference to immune suppression, inflammation and tumour recurrence in peri-operative breast cancer patients. With this background it would interesting to compare the effect of isoflurane and propofol on immune suppression, inflammation and metastasis in perioperative breast cancer patients. Objective To compare the effects of two different anaesthetic agents, Isoflurane and Propofol in peri-operative settings of carcinoma breast, those are evident by the alteration of the following three biological markers- 1. Immune phenotype of peripheral blood lymphocytes (CD4, CD8, CD19, CD56) 2. Expression of serum inflammatory markers (TNF-a, IL-6, IL-8, IL-10) 3. Activity of serum matrix metalloproteinase (MMP-2 and MMP-9) Subjects/samples Selection of participants The newly diagnosed breast cancer patients will be asked to participate in the study. Informed consent in either of the three vernaculars- English, Bengali or Hindi will be obtained from each participant. The demographic information will be obtained with screening form and participants will be chosen according to inclusion and exclusion criteria. Inclusion Criteria 1. Age between 18-65 yrs (both inclusive) 2. Newly diagnosed breast cancer (Unilateral) confirmed with histopathological diagnosis. 3. ASA I (Normal healthy patient) & ASA II (Patient with mild systemic disease) 4. T1 N0, T2N0, T3N0, T1N1, T2N1, T3N1 Mx 5. Both male & female 6. Duration of surgery ≤ to 2 hrs. Exclusion Criteria 1. Patient having any kind of anticancer treatment 2. Active bleeding 3. Recent history of massive blood transfusion 4. Pregnant & Lactating woman The patients will be randomized to Arm-A & Arm-B according to a computer generated random number table and will be assigned to receive either propofol infusion or isoflurane inhalation for maintenance of anaesthesia.
Collection of blood samples Venous blood samples (5 ml) will be collected after obtaining informed consent, from ante-cubital vein in ‘vacutainer’ tubes (BD, USA) without anticoagulant. For serum, the blood will be anti-coagulated with K2EDTA. Blood samples will be collected 1day before surgery, during surgery (1 hr after incision) and 48 hours after surgery. Blood samples will be drawn by persons authorized to do phlebotomy (clinicians / technicians of CNCI hospital). |
